Confirmed the leak in the Bramblewick image cache: evicted entries keep a strong reference through the decode callback, so the release never frees bitmaps under sustained scroll. Fix swaps to weak handles and adds a hard byte ceiling with LRU trim on memory pressure. Verified on the Northquay test fleet — heap stays flat over a two-hour soak. Safe to take into the release branch; risk is low, changes are contained to one module. Shipping constants are below.

tuning table, yajog-yahof:
BUDGETS = {
    "lamvan": 303,
    "wenox": 460,
    "fenvan": 525,
}

MEMO — Kettling Depot Receiving

Uniform sets for the new Kettling depot arrive Wednesday via Ashgrove courier: 40 boxes, sorted by size, manifest attached to box one. Check the count at the dock before signing; shortages go straight to stores, not the courier. The hand-over instruction the courier will follow is set out below.

drop instructions, tafof-baguf: the holmir gilox courier leaves the sormir ulaok holdor ledger at gate 5596 under passcode 257343

Break-glass access for DocSweep, our documentation linter. Contractors normally use scoped tokens; break-glass applies only when the token service is down and a release is blocked. Open the emergency console on the linter host and request an override session. The console will ask for the recovery passphrase, which appears below.

strongbox words: norwyn-wenael-aldvan-aldiel-wendor-holael